Drury University Romance Languages Bachelor’s Degrees

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, Drury University awarded 6 bachelor’s degrees in romance languages.

Bachelor’s Student Diversity

In the most recent graduating class, 17% of romance languages bachelor’s degrees went to men and 83% went to women.

Drury University gender breakdown of Romance Languages Bachelor's degree grads The majority of romance languages bachelor’s degree graduates at Drury University are White. About 100% of graduates fell into this category.

Spanish Language and Literature (Bachelor’s)

Drury University conferred 5 bachelor’s degrees in spanish language and literature in the latest year of data — 100% to women and 0% to men. The largest share of these graduates were White (100%).

French Language and Literature (Bachelor’s)

Drury University granted 1 bachelor’s degree in french language and literature recently — 0% to women and 100% to men. The largest share of these graduates were White (100%).
